Hi, the heirloom-mailx package has been removed in version 14.9.4-1. You
likely have an old version of the package installed. Relevant changelog
excerpt:

s-nail (14.9.4-1) unstable; urgency=medium

  * New upstream version 14.9.4
  * Modernize package: DH compat level, Vcs-* URL, Standards-Version
  * Remove heirloom-mailx transitional package (Closes: #876871)
